# Part 1
from toolz import curry, compose
from functools import reduce, wraps
from operator import add
from typing import Any, Callable, List, TypeVar
poem = "occasional clouds\none gets a rest\nfrom moon-viewing\n"
@curry
def unlines(s: [str]) -> str:
return s[0] + '\n' + unlines(s[1:]) if len(s)>0 else ""
def lines(s: str) -> [str]:
return s.splitlines()
def words(s: str) -> [str]:
return s.split()
def unwords(s: [str]) -> str:
return s[0] + " " + unwords(s[1:]) if len(s)> 0 else ""
def sort(s: [str]) -> [str]:
return sorted(s)
def reverse(s: [str]) -> [str]:
return[x[::-1] for x in s]
def takeTwo(s: [str]) -> [str]:
return s[0:2] if len(s) >= 2 else s
process = compose(unlines, sort, lines)
sortLines = compose(unlines, sort, lines)
reverseLines = compose(unlines, reverse, lines)
firstTwoLines =compose(unlines, takeTwo, lines)
@curry
def byLines(f: Callable[[Any],Any], s: str) -> str:
return unlines(f(lines(s)))
# return compose(unlines, f, lines(s))
@curry
def indent(s: str) -> str:
return " " + s
def indentEachLine(s: str) -> str:
return compose(unlines, list) (map (indent, lines(s)))
def eachLine(f: Callable[[Any],Any], s: str) -> str:
return compose(unlines, list) (map (f,(lines(s))))
def yell(s: str) -> str:
return s.upper() + "!!!"
def yellEachLine(s: str) -> str:
return eachLine(yell, s)
def eachWord(f: Callable[[Any],Any], s: str) -> str:
return compose(unwords, list) (map(f,(words(s))))
def yellEachWord(s: str) -> str:
return eachWord(yell, s)
def eachWordOnEachLine(f: Callable[[Any],Any], s: str) -> str:
return (eachWord(f,s))
def yellEachWordOnEachLine(s: str) -> str:
return (eachWordOnEachLine(yell, s))
if __name__ == '__main__':
# import doctest
# doctest.testmod(verbose=True)
# print(sortLines(poem))
# print(reverseLines(poem))
# print(firstTwoLines(poem))
# print(byLines(sort, poem))
# print(byLines(reverse, poem))
# print(byLines(takeTwo, poem))
# print((indentEachLine(poem)))
# print(yellEachLine(poem))
# print(yellEachWord(poem))
# print(eachWordOnEachLine(yell, poem))
print(yellEachWordOnEachLine(poem))
